mxGeneralDialog method

Future mxGeneralDialog(
  1. WidgetBuilder wb, {
  2. bool isBarrierDismiss = true,
  3. Color? barrierColor,
})

Implementation

Future<dynamic> mxGeneralDialog(WidgetBuilder wb,
    {bool isBarrierDismiss = true, Color? barrierColor}) {
  return showGeneralDialog(
      context: this!,
      barrierLabel: '',
      barrierColor: barrierColor ?? const Color(0x80000000),
      barrierDismissible: isBarrierDismiss,
      transitionDuration: Duration(milliseconds: 250),
      pageBuilder: (ctx, Animation<double> animation,
          Animation<double> secondaryAnimation) {
        return VxAnimatedBox(child: wb(ctx))
            .elasticIn
            .animDuration(Duration(milliseconds: 350))
            .make();
      });
}